[email protected]和[email protected]
#pragma once
#include <stdio.h>
#include <string>
#include <list>
#include <iostream>
#import "c:\Program Files\Common Files\System\ADO\msado15.dll" no_namespace rename("EOF", "adoEOF")
using namespace std;
class ConnObj
{
public:
_ConnectionPtr conn;
bool isUsed;
bool isTrans;
int usedCount;
public:
void OpenConn();
void CloseConn();
public:
ConnObj(void);
~ConnObj(void);
};
#include "StdAfx.h"
#include "ConnObj.h"
ConnObj::ConnObj(void)
{
isUsed = false;
isTrans = false;
usedCount = 0;
}
ConnObj::~ConnObj(void)
{
}
void ConnObj::OpenConn()
{
_bstr_t strConnect= "Provider=SQLOLEDB;Server=localhost;Database=bty_db_main;uid=sa; pwd=123";
conn.CreateInstance("ADODB.Connection");
conn->Open(strConnect,"","",adModeUnknown);
}
void ConnObj::CloseConn()
{
conn->Close();
conn = NULL;
}